Mlife
| Fiscal year | Revenue | Expenses | Net | Reserve mo. | Staff % |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2021 | 152,431 | 148,347 | 4,084 | 0.9 | 2% |
| 2022 | 47,526 | 77,948 | −30,422 | -2.9 | 28% |
| 2023 | 82,885 | 115,993 | −33,108 | -5.4 | 26% |
In its most recent public year (2023), this organization spent $33,108 more than it brought in. Its liabilities exceeded its net assets — reserves were below zero (-5.4 months), down from 0.9 in 2021. Staff pay was 26% of spending.
